3-Bromo-5-chloro-2-pyridinecarbonitrile

Description:
3-Bromo-5-chloro-2-pyridinecarbonitrile is a heterocyclic organic compound characterized by the presence of a pyridine ring substituted with both bromine and chlorine atoms, as well as a cyano group. Its molecular structure features a pyridine ring, which is a six-membered aromatic ring containing one nitrogen atom. The bromine and chlorine substituents are located at the 3 and 5 positions, respectively, while the cyano group (-C≡N) is attached to the 2 position of the pyridine ring. This compound is typically a solid at room temperature and may exhibit moderate solubility in organic solvents. It is of interest in various fields, including medicinal chemistry and agrochemicals, due to its potential biological activity and utility in synthesizing other chemical compounds. The presence of halogens and a cyano group can influence its reactivity and interactions with biological targets. Safety data should be consulted for handling, as halogenated compounds can pose health risks.
Formula:C6H2BrClN2
InChI:InChI=1S/C6H2BrClN2/c7-5-1-4(8)3-10-6(5)2-9/h1,3H
InChI key:InChIKey=AAGYWTCZOUXEDH-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:C(#N)C1=C(Br)C=C(Cl)C=N1
Synonyms:
  • 2-Pyridinecarbonitrile, 3-bromo-5-chloro-
  • 3-Bromo-5-Chloro-2-Cyanopyridine
  • 3-Bromo-5-chloro-2-pyridinecarbonitrile
  • 3-Bromo-5-chloropicolinonitrile
